For over 100 years, we’ve been bringing the world closer together by crafting journeys that create lasting memories, lifelong friendships and meaningful cultural connections. Across more than 70 countries and our award-winning brands, we design and deliver travel experiences that go beyond sightseeing - they change perspectives.

This is a chance to help build the modern data foundations behind TTC's growing Data and AI capability. You will design and develop reliable pipelines and trusted data products across customer, booking, digital, marketing, commercial and operational data, enabling analytics, data science and better decisions across our global portfolio of travel brands.

You will work in a modern Snowflake-based ecosystem alongside senior engineers, data scientists, analysts and data product colleagues, turning complex data into accessible, reusable, high-quality assets. Build and maintain scalable, production-grade pipelines across customer, booking, digital, commercial and operational domains.

Turn raw data into trusted, reusable and well-modelled products for Analytics, Data Science and AI. Develop solutions in Snowflake, SQL, Python and modern transformation tooling such as dbt. Implement automated testing, data quality controls, monitoring and observability across critical datasets.

Apply modern engineering practice including Git, code review, automated testing and CI/CD. Monitor and optimise workloads for performance, scalability, resilience and cost. Partner with Data Science, Insight and Data Product colleagues to translate needs into solid technical solutions.

Investigate data quality and pipeline issues, find root causes and fix them properly.
